Myanmar Daily Weather Report
(Issued at 7:00 am Tuesday 20thJuly, 2021)
BAY INFERENCE:Monsoon isstrong to vigorous over theAndaman Sea andSouth Bay and weak to moderate elsewhere over the Bay of Bengal.
FORECAST VALID UNTIL EVENING OF THE 20th July, 2021:Rain or thundershowers will bescattered in Sagaing, Magway Regions and Kachin State, fairly widespread in Naypyitaw, Mandalay Regions and Chin State and widespreadin the remaining Regions and States with likelihood of regionally heavyfalls in Kayin and Mon States and isolated heavyfalls in Lower Sagaing, Mandalay, Magway, Taninthayi Regions and Shan, Rakhine States. Degree of certainty is (100%).
STATE OF THE SEA:Squalls with rough seas are likely at times Deltaic, Gulf of Mottama, off and along Mon-Taninthayi Coasts. Surface wind speed in squalls may reach (35-40)m.p.h. Sea will bemoderate elsewhere in Myanmar waters. Wave height will be about (8-10)feet in Deltaic, Gulf of Mottama, off and along Mon-Taninthayi Coasts and (6-8)feet in off and along Rakhine Coasts.
OUTLOOK FOR SUBSEQUENT TWO DAYS:Increase of rain in Bago, Yangon, Ayeyarwady, Taninthayi Regions and Rakhine, Kayin, Mon States.
FORECAST FOR NAYPYITAW AND NEIGHBOURING AREA FOR 20thJuly, 2021: Isolated rain or thundershowers.Degree of certainty is (100%).
FORECAST FOR YANGON AND NEIGHBOURING AREA FOR 20thJuly,2021: Some rain or thundershowers.Degree of certainty is (100%).
FORECAST FOR MANDALAY AND NEIGHBOURINGAREA FOR 20thJuly, 2021: Isolated rain or thundershowers. Degree of certainty is (100%).
